反事实条件
致力于捕获在自然语言中的“如果-那么”陈述的条件陈述
反事实条件又名虚拟条件,是致力于捕获在自然语言中的“如果-那么”陈述的条件陈述,其与实质条件陈述不同,反事实条件可以为假,即使它的前提为真。
直陈条件,可以在这种情况下为假。例如,陈述“如果小明在墨西哥,则小明在非洲” 将典型的被认为是假。但是,如果小明当前不在墨西哥,则对应的逻辑条件是真。换句话说,如果陈述“小明在墨西哥” 和 “小明在非洲” 被分别的形式化为命题 m 和 a,你可能不希望第一个蕴涵第二个。不过,如果 m 当前为假,则 m→a 在命题逻辑中是真。
为了区分反事实条件和实质条件,定义了符号 > ,所以 A > B 意味着 “如果 A,则 B”。
反事实条件 A > B 的语义不能用条件 A 和 B 的真值表的方式定义,因为那是给实质条件用的。实际上有些不同的情况在 A 和 B 的真值上是一致的,但是仍希望给出不同的 A > B 的求值。 例如,如果小明在德国,则下列两个条件都有假的前件和假的后件:
如果小明在墨西哥,则小明在非洲。如果小明在墨西哥,则小明在北美。实际上,如果小明在德国,则所有三个情况 “小明在墨西哥”、“小明在非洲” 和 “小明在北美” 都是假的。但是,第一种情况明显是假的: 墨西哥不在非洲;第二种情况是真的: 墨西哥是北美国家。
参考资料
最新修订时间:2023-11-29 15:09
目录
概述
参考资料